央广网北京7月1日消息(总台央广记者李杨)近日,我国首个桌面操作系统开发者平台“开放麒麟”正式发布。该平台由国家工业信息安全发展研究中心等单位联合成立,将打造具有自主创新技术的开源桌面操作系统。
近年来,我国的国产操作系统逐渐普及,但在一些核心技术上尚待突破,“开放麒麟”开发者平台将通过开放操作系统源代码的方式,让更多开发者共同参与国产开源操作系统的开发。“开放麒麟”的出现如何推动国产操作系统的创新发展?
操作系统按应用领域可以划分为四种:桌面操作系统、服务器操作系统、移动操作系统和其他操作系统(云、嵌入式、物联网操作系统等)。我国的桌面操作系统起步较晚,大部分计算机用户使用的是国外进口的操作系统。
麒麟软件公司副总裁李震宁表示,开发者平台“开放麒麟”主要的作用就是聚拢桌面操作系统研发里最精锐的国家级产业和学术队伍,共同把生态、人才、技术聚拢在一起,打造一个最顶尖的社区版本。“open Kylin(开放麒麟)社区里面有国内十几家操作系统厂商和相关科研机构,也有7位院士以及相关的技术专家,这些人在一起一定可以做出一个好用易用,而且开放的桌面操作系统平台。另外一方面,社区本身是一个完全开放的环境,不管是厂商还是开发者个人,只要愿意都可以来这里进行软件、硬件或者解决方案的适配、迁移。这样就可以帮助我们快速聚拢一大批基于我们自主开源桌面操作系统的生态能力,快速打造开源社区的核心价值能力体系。”
近年来,我国的国产操作系统逐渐普及,但在一些核心技术上尚待突破。“开放麒麟”开发者平台将通过开放操作系统源代码的方式,让更多开发者共同参与国产开源操作系统的开发。
在未来智安CTO陈毓端看来,要做好整个网络安全和操作系统的安全,需要做好顶层设计,在此基础上,不同的厂商加入进来,让生态体系不断完善。陈毓端说:“为什么像微软操作系统能发展成全球最大的操作系统?它的生态比较完整,各个环节的链条比较完整。对于我们国产操作系统来说,整个生态的建设是最大的问题,也是后期最应该去发力的点。对于生态的建设其实是要有顶层设计的,比如桌面系统的应用软件要足够丰富,才能快速推进这款操作系统在各个行业的应用,如果你的生态都没有,各种应用都比较缺失,整体是用不起来的。安全不能靠一个厂商或者一家公司去完成,它需要社会各个方面,各个网络安全公司、各个科技公司共同去参与。”
李震宁补充说,其实目前国产操作系统不管是在启动速度还是在应用上,跟微软和macOS相比在技术层面差别不大,最大的差别是在生态上。李震宁表示:“就拿在操作系统上适配的软件或者硬件生态来说,微软有1000万以上的软件和硬件生态,苹果有100万以上的软件和硬件生态,而目前我们现在做得最好的麒麟操作系统,它的软件和硬件生态只有40万,和人家的差别非常大。我们打造这个open Kylin的根社区,就是希望通过开源社区聚拢更多软件和硬件的开发商或者个人,极大地促进软硬件生态适配建设,尽快追平和微软或者苹果操作系统的生态差异,这是我们现在的核心目标之一。”
李震宁介绍,原来的国产操作系统,它的开源社区来源是国外的社区,现在打造一个完全国内主导研发的开源社区,就不再依赖国外的开源社区进行技术改造,这是本质上的区别,而且安全性也更有保证。
李震宁说:“从安全性来说,因为国家有自己的国密算法、有相关的安全保护体系,我们会对整个操作系统的密码、算法等按照国家要求进行相关的技术改造,使它能够符合现在国家的安全保密规定,和我们现在一些安全系统能够进行对接。另外一方面,操作系统的厂商或者共同的发起方里,有专门从事安全的研究机构,在他们这些专业能力的加持下,对我们的操作系统专门进行安全加固,保证我们的系统能够安全而且合规。”
信息网络技术专家包冉表示,动辄上亿行几十亿行上百亿行代码的操作系统,即使没有任何黑客或者别有用心人的操作,它出现漏洞也是不可避免的,国产操作系统的出现对于安全性的保障很有必要。
包冉说:“像大家比较熟悉的Windows、苹果桌面级的macOS,都是没有100%安全的、无漏洞的操作系统。当你发现漏洞的时候,不太有能力第一时间去给它打补丁,这样我们的网络安全就有了一个空窗期。当有极端情况出现的时候,禁用了相当重要的一些基础功能,这显然也对整体社会安全和国家安全不利。基于这两个必要性,我们一定要搞基于开源的、可控的操作系统。”
包冉表示,对于一款新的操作系统来说,重点不在于品牌宣传,而在于产品自身的实力。“我个人建议实实在在地多做一些,真真正正地让自己的操作系统先跑起来,收集种子用户的使用反馈来不断完善自己的产品,然后一步一步地、扎扎实实地走上去。这里也有个正面案例就是WPS。WPS从最早艰难地走到现在,事实上WPS在移动端的装机用户远远超过了微软的Office在移动端的装机用户,为什么?(因为)他们对移动端产品的优化体验实在是比微软的Office好太多了,产品力才是最关键的。”